This guide is for DIY enthusiasts and professionals working with ceramic tiles up to 10mm thick. The Vitrex Tile Cutter offers a quick and easy way to score and snap tiles without the need for large cutters or saws. However, it's designed for smaller tiles and may not be suitable for large format projects.

FAQs

What type of tiles can I cut with this cutter?

This cutter is designed for ceramic tiles up to 10mm thick.

How do I replace the scoring wheel?

Refer to the product manual for detailed instructions on replacing the scoring wheel.

Can I use this cutter on porcelain tiles?

The cutter is primarily designed for ceramic tiles; it may not perform as well on porcelain.

How do I ensure a straight cut?

Use a straight edge to guide the scoring wheel along a straight line.

What should I do if the tile cutter feels stiff?

Ensure all moving parts are clean and free of debris. Lubricate if necessary.

Troubleshooting

Tile is not snapping cleanly.

Ensure the tile is scored deeply enough. Apply even pressure when snapping the tile.

Scoring wheel is not cutting smoothly.

Check the scoring wheel for damage or debris. Replace if necessary.

Difficulty maintaining a straight cut.

Use a straight edge to guide the scoring wheel.

Pros and Cons

Pros

  • Easy to use for scoring and snapping tiles.
  • Durable construction with a steel body.
  • Precise cutting with the tungsten carbide scoring wheel.
  • Compact and portable for easy handling.
  • Suitable for DIY projects and small-scale tiling jobs.

Cons

  • Limited to tiles up to 10mm thick.
  • Not suitable for large format tiles.
  • Manual operation may require practice for perfect cuts.
  • May not be ideal for intricate or complex cuts.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

  1. Setup: Ensure the tile is clean and dry. Position the tile on a stable surface.
  2. Compatibility: Compatible with ceramic tiles up to 10mm thick.
  3. Care: After each use, wipe the scoring wheel with a clean cloth. Store the tile cutter in a dry place. Check the scoring wheel regularly and replace it if it becomes dull or damaged.
